September marks National Preparedness Month, and Washington City, Utah, is urging residents to take proactive steps to prepare for emergencies.
The city recommends building or updating disaster kits with essentials such as water, nonperishable food, medications, flashlights, batteries, and important documents.

Impact & Risks

The initiative aims to mitigate risks associated with natural disasters such as wildfires, severe weather, and power outages. By encouraging residents to prepare in advance, the city hopes to reduce the potential for harm and ensure that families can respond effectively during emergencies. The focus on family communication plans and evacuation routes is particularly important for minimizing confusion and ensuring safety during critical situations.
